3rd world Tom and Jerry
by Rusty-342001-09-05
4/10

"I am never too fond of the Gene Deitch Tom and Jerry shorts. Some of them really feel like you're going through one heck of a nightmare. The scenics are not as good as the Hanna-Barbara cartoons, and the human characters...they're terribly one-dimensional and usually very cold and terrifying to be near. Some of them are downright creepy. This certain one didn't give me the creeps fully, but it also wasn't that funny. Those human characters (the Sheriff and the Cheese Store owner) were no laughing matter, and were more like monsters of pure evil. William Hanna and Joseph Ba..."

💡 Did You Know?

Tedd Pierce and Bill Danch originally pitched this as a Sylvester and Speedy Gonzales cartoon when they were working on the Looney Tunes series, but director Robert McKimson was unhappy with the original story and asked for rewrites. By the time Pierce and Danch were able to carry out the rewrites, Warner Bros. had shut down their animation department, leading to the two selling their story to Gene Deitch, who retooled it into a Tom and Jerry short.
